Samsung band selection is just an app in Play Store.  Once downloaded open app, click “more network settings” - “prefered network type” -    and select the last option  “NR/LTE……….GSM/WCDMA. 

you will then pick up 5g when in a 5g area.  Also you can check your preferred network type will show 5g/4g/3g/2g (auto)      Note though - if you restart your phone for any reason this will all need to be redone.
